    31 /* stackwalker_selftest_sol.s
    32  * On Solaris, the recommeded compiler is CC, so we can not use gcc inline
    33  * asm, use this method instead.
    34  *
    35  * How to compile: as -P -L -D_ASM -D_STDC -K PIC -o \
    36  *                 src/processor/stackwalker_selftest_sol.o \
    37  *                 src/processor/stackwalker_selftest_sol.s
    38  *
    39  * Author: Michael Shang
    40  */
